Reduce/Enlarge (Making Enlarged/Reduced Copies)

You can select a ratio to make enlarged or reduced copies.
1
Select the copy ratio from [Reduce/
Enlarge].
100%
Copies are made at the same size as the original document.
Auto %
The copy ratio is automatically set based upon the document and paper sizes specified
in [Paper Supply], and the document is copied to fit in the specified paper size.
